Definitions
n.名词 noun
- 1
- : the act of interjecting.
- : something interjected, as a remark.
- : the utterance of a word or phrase expressive of emotion; the uttering of an exclamation.
- : Grammar. any member of a class of words expressing emotion, distinguished in most languages by their use in grammatical isolation, as Hey! Oh! Ouch! Ugh!any other word or expression so used, as Good grief! Indeed!
